What are lox?

Lox refers to a fillet of brined salmon that is commonly served in thin slices, often on a bagel with cream cheese, onions, capers, and tomatoes. The term 'lox' originates from the Yiddish word for salmon and has become a staple in Jewish delicatessens, particularly in the United States. Traditional lox is made from the belly of the salmon and is cured in a salt brine, not smoked, which distinguishes it from smoked salmon or gravlax. Lox is prized for its silky texture and salty flavor, making it a popular choice for breakfast and brunch dishes.
